Masks
Perhaps the most unique offering in Slipknot’s merch arsenal is their masks. Each band member wears a custom mask reflecting their persona, and these evolve with every album cycle. Official replicas are sold through their site or at events like Knotfest, and these are hot commodities for collectors and cosplayers alike.
The masks aren’t just merchandise—they are an extension of the band’s mythology. Wearing one is an immersive way to embody the dark energy and mystery that Slipknot projects on stage.
Vinyl and Music Collectibles
In an era of digital music, Slipknot still caters to audiophiles and collectors by releasing special vinyl editions of their albums. These often feature exclusive artwork, colored records, and bonus tracks. Fans frequently display them as art or keep them sealed for long-term value.
Limited edition box sets and deluxe albums also come with custom packaging, artwork booklets, and even patches or small posters, offering more than just music—it's an experience.
